0 something that someone says or writes officially, or an action done to express an opinion -- (正式的)說明;聲明;表態
The government is expected to issue a statement about the investigation to the press. 預計政府會就該調查向媒體作出說明。
He produced a signed statement from the prisoner. 他出示了一份犯人簽字畫押的口供。
He threw paint over the fur coats because he wanted to make a statement about cruelty to animals. ,借此表明自己對虐待動物一事的態度。
[ + that ] We were not surprised by their statement that jobs would be cut. 我們對他們宣佈將進行裁員的消息並不感到吃驚。
